Two Nizwa University Students Participate in International Mathematics Olympiad in Belarus

 

 

Two students from the University of Nizwa, Raya Khalifa Al Kindi and Zubaida Ahmed Al Abdali, participated in the Open Mathematical Olympiad for University Students, held in Belarus from February 17 to 21, 2025.

The competition brought together students worldwide to solve complex mathematical problems, testing their analytical and logical thinking skills. Raya and Zubaida, representing Oman and the Arab world, demonstrated strong abilities, reflecting the quality of education they received at the University of Nizwa. Their participation highlighted their talent and strengthened the university’s international presence.

Their team was the sole representative from Arab countries, adding significance to their participation.

Alongside the competition, Dr. Khalifa bin Zayid Al Shaqsi, the academic supervisor, presented a research paper on innovative approaches to teaching mathematics at the university level. His presentation explored methods for nurturing mathematical talent and fostering critical thinking. The research contributed to academic discussions and reinforced the University of Nizwa’s standing in global education.
